US mobile handset producer
Motorola has opened a flagship store in the center of the Russian capital, Moscow, Motorola said in a press release Wednesday.
The store, called Red Square MOTO, was opened in the GUM mall, which is located on Russia''s Red Square.
Red Square MOTO is the first Motorola store in Russia, the company said.
In December 2005 Finland''s
Nokia, a rival of Motorola, opened a store in Moscow close to Pushkin Square, a kilometer away from Red Square.
